Авторизация
Забыли пароль? Введите ваш е-мейл адрес. Вы получите письмо на почту со ссылкой для восстановления пароля.
После регистрации вы сможете задавать вопросы и писать свои ответы, получая за это бонусы. Все остальные функции на сайте доступны без регистрации.
Вы должны войти или зарегистрироваться, чтобы добавить ответ и получить бонусы.
Clearfix в CSS — это техника, используемая для решения проблемы с обтеканием элементов, которые находятся рядом с элементом с плавающим свойством.
Когда элемент имеет свойство float: left или float: right, он выходит из потока документа и может вызывать проблемы с обтеканием для следующих элементов. Clearfix используется для создания контейнера, который содержит плавающие элементы и предотвращает обтекание.
Чтобы создать clearfix, можно использовать следующий CSS-код:
.clearfix::after {
content: «»;
display: table;
clear: both;
}
.clearfix {
zoom: 1;
}
Этот код создает псевдоэлемент ::after для элемента с классом «clearfix», который очищает обтекание и создает блочный элемент, который занимает всю доступную ширину. Затем с помощью свойства zoom: 1 мы создаем контекст форматирования для элемента clearfix, чтобы он работал в старых версиях Internet Explorer.